Why rename_file needs a policy

Renaming files is a Write operation—it modifies metadata reversibly and can be undone. The severity is medium because misuse could rename critical files to break applications or configurations, but the action is reversible unlike destructive operations. Confidence is high based on clear description of rename functionality.

From the tool's definition Tool description states '重命名文件或目录' (rename file or directory), which is a reversible modification operation. The phrase '只改变名称不改变位置' emphasizes it only changes the name, confirming it does not delete or permanently destroy data.

Can I rate-limit rename_file?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the rename_file r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block rename_file complet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for rename_file.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
